Answers: Not to worry! Those should bloom again, adjectives summer for you, but you might not have a bloom every daylight. As long as the leaves have not turned sickly or brown, or withered, you still have a hygienic plant.
Things gerberas do not like are excessive cold, excessive grill or wet foot. They like to be watered but not moved out in a puddle for too long. Aside from that they are not grumpy. When the blooms start to fade, deadheading the flowers will encourage more blooming. Why, to be exact exactly what you did!
